Fwd: Stalled post to pgsql-general

Поиск
Список
Период
Сортировка
От Jim Nasby
Тема Fwd: Stalled post to pgsql-general
Дата
Msg-id 63de2785-e70c-72c3-7edd-cf4b4425d17f@nasby.net
обсуждение исходный текст
Ответы Re: Fwd: Stalled post to pgsql-general  (Joe Conway <mail@joeconway.com>)
Список pgsql-www
Just got this bounce for headers too large. While I admit 8K of headers 
is a bit excessive, I don't think there's anything I can do to affect 
that, and I suspect this could bite any other office365 users.


-------- Forwarded Message --------
Received: from DM5PR11MB1643.namprd11.prod.outlook.com (10.172.38.14) by 
CY4PR11MB1637.namprd11.prod.outlook.com (10.172.71.13) with Microsoft 
SMTP Server (version=TLS1_2, 
c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384_P384) id 15.1.544.10 via 
Mailbox Transport; Thu, 21 Jul 2016 22:03:57 +0000
Received: from SN1PR11CA0005.namprd11.prod.outlook.com (10.164.10.15) by 
DM5PR11MB1643.namprd11.prod.outlook.com (10.172.38.14) with Microsoft 
SMTP Server (version=TLS1_2, 
c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384_P384) id 15.1.544.10; Thu, 
21 Jul 2016 22:03:56 +0000
Received: from BY2FFO11FD047.protection.gbl (2a01:111:f400:7c0c::161) by 
SN1PR11CA0005.outlook.office365.com (2a01:111:e400:c47b::15) with 
Microsoft SMTP Server (version=TLS1_2, 
c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384_P384) id 15.1.544.10 via 
Frontend Transport; Thu, 21 Jul 2016 22:03:57 +0000
Authentication-Results: spf=none (sender IP is 217.196.149.56) 
smtp.mailfrom=postgresql.org; bluetreble.com; dkim=none (message not 
signed) header.d=none;bluetreble.com; dmarc=none action=none 
header.from=postgresql.org;bluetreble.com; dkim=none (message not 
signed) header.d=none;
Received-SPF: None (protection.outlook.com: postgresql.org does not 
designate permitted sender hosts)
Received: from malur.postgresql.org (217.196.149.56) by 
BY2FFO11FD047.mail.protection.outlook.com (10.1.15.175) with Microsoft 
SMTP Server (TLS) id 15.1.523.9 via Frontend Transport; Thu, 21 Jul 2016 
22:03:56 +0000
Received: from localhost ([127.0.0.1] helo=postgresql.org) by 
malur.postgresql.org with esmtp (Exim 4.84_2) (envelope-from 
<pgsql-general-owner@postgresql.org>) id 1bQM4Q-0006ap-PT for 
Jim.Nasby@bluetreble.com; Thu, 21 Jul 2016 22:03:54 +0000
X-Mailer: MIME-tools 5.505 (Entity 5.505)
Date: Thu, 21 Jul 2016 22:03:54 +0000
From: pgsql-general-owner@postgresql.org
To: Jim Nasby <Jim.Nasby@BlueTreble.com>
Subject: Stalled post to pgsql-general
Content-Type: multipart/mixed; boundary="----------=_1469138634-25343-1"
Message-ID: <4ddb29a3f2c85076e3b5e98919de59c7e4582bc8@postgresql.org>
Return-Path: pgsql-general-owner@postgresql.org
X-MS-Exchange-Organization-Network-Message-Id: 
04a8d802-ceba-4a0c-d722-08d3b1b2e97a
X-EOPAttributedMessage: 0
X-EOPTenantAttributedMessage: 05027110-dcb3-458e-866d-b4ec88120732:0
X-MS-Exchange-Organization-MessageDirectionality: Incoming
X-Forefront-Antispam-Report: 

CIP:217.196.149.56;IPV:NLI;CTRY:AT;EFV:NLI;SFV:NSPM;SFS:(6009001)(8156002)(2980300002)(428002)(199003)(189002)(119626001)(512954002)(9786002)(5003600100003)(7696003)(6806005)(7596002)(33646002)(450100001)(7636002)(7846002)(77096005)(86152002)(8676002)(19580395003)(36756003)(2876002)(19580405001)(50226002)(305945005)(86362001)(8896002)(356003)(106466001)(1096003)(246002)(2476003)(229853001)(4610100001)(76506005)(57986006)(586003)(84326002)(189998001)(260700001)(105586002)(101416001)(270700001)(100306002)(110136002)(107886002)(104016004)(5000100001)(92566002)(118296001)(50986999)(42522002);DIR:INB;SFP:;SCL:1;SRVR:DM5PR11MB1643;H:malur.postgresql.org;FPR:;SPF:None;PTR:malur.postgresql.org;A:1;MX:1;LANG:en;
X-Microsoft-Exchange-Diagnostics: 

1;BY2FFO11FD047;1:gX01l8cSrAovXBqwjbll1lXewmGY+AaKBvz1LFNpSUX7YhWybduwNjHkIIEpRiBvwiZ9xUvZIl8Tuz9zWGgOqjX+7gQjeQWl3u5OzsBz2icnm60WR/kgJHUwQEhbjeTUBwFe3zOwHSemM2UEjUY3h/17H+z58RytAkxz2OJX0wLIh13XNFaBdqG6Y8Aq0J2/UmuhzjsS/TkVbMIc7RVvfXz/EEzY+s0GfgjXjnfp13nVZWthD0hK7Vq5QA5tuBh1GS1P3WVShlUL7gObiXm2No3WJkkxMZXYs8J8/uwZnwLQ0jghDQqQJUxFt/+vAk22lKofcBM8Fy16PUrO/+pGvX7KR231nUkmeLEMwv+JZKZ/VopLxXB9iBXovI63IWIjXOtCTPqUSh6++FCA6ru7euFSPm1jefD4olMCOVq47th9SHPHETBBfxols5yUrOmQ17VzheWdu7Zdh2dEdr7gZSTM/K/rh+uN7k8IfFJXEGwR6MsCdKJewrT13+WRUQvEETLUHU9+G15eYFUol408yD5VL6laViWQr3qn5GgSvwI=
X-MS-Office365-Filtering-Correlation-Id: 
04a8d802-ceba-4a0c-d722-08d3b1b2e97a
X-Microsoft-Exchange-Diagnostics: 

1;DM5PR11MB1643;2:PuNGhv3woG6M2xZFuHem+4elbJCdy1xDpx4rFQAS1J2e8Z8yP+unAZDj21KamNk4MFVijSL841mAjq57faOo/nUFK2iB6MHpitbMe7FOTs9PBQcQc+8e+AYRk5SCEpkGlAF6TsSXm8vFhZEnVIdqR1XjcXQPD2wDxPdLwQVT4cutEIkVUgFVXZX7ki2spHnL;3:B07hKfRrN4qZAF9kTsZzD6rA1r8/ohu8ImZo7bXB7Y6ISR11N0Tf572I+r03ETaEtM2C1tc9jmgf8y3IsC5QOeaKHB8COQX/soZSfYoF9icrclSbf9VQI+TIoWCsajHCDwkGhK8EeVp/pPwZj70VhshqL+snwNqOXPQkSk61LYOpqPPgDxfNdXTVqpOocrHWzBC/wmYLXE9mYb+Fh1cfyNuE4kPl4xVoD6/G1W1lThRUz24URJ2npDqXDDpnQNRimEn5FSgkFttp0ypH2a7zNinQcz3R3Ri0AdpvtoB06pc=
X-Microsoft-Antispam: 
UriScan:;BCL:0;PCL:0;RULEID:(71701004)(71702002);SRVR:DM5PR11MB1643;
X-Microsoft-Exchange-Diagnostics: 

1;DM5PR11MB1643;25:14dWTkoADPHCf+NNUEjYi24eEy4QbFiV3YfJCjmrwpSzsyd3U6UZ9KPDPGGUQpFjUuwVZBdmG7CpkNK+3BH/leKCVMtFa3uwHnht50vkYvs+kE+Pdy/TfePYHxSb1/ojvxaHdoYlvWcnMydfsKZxLA2pw95PJzrtMSVu/oIggaT9/oJ5nypCITi9eRQz4NDr7ez7gYJHOl/u+kdSL++DaSULW+htocSBiD0ibeNmzYVIU/KE3p11lj4rQBwHBte97xzRZkpXuv9DeIVvWebH2HzGSgibZ+Nj570FwEOtcFV69+K+vJs4rdEcCVYe+d5q5OoTffjaVe4OmpRSKTAySW7sLmA0DOv9Xs6PV146vaFHB/ghl1Q0st45H+Ts/7ivoL4on5yWE2xMyInnN5xg3dG4uvxcXLAblAVCcjYj/UFjhR3GJs/5tjpfN6FVGtuToS2yNv3L4npnObr1N8HaakcygNsgwGQsQgPPuqz++5eexqX6TiNjcYo59zxo7vAX0DRc0wgjIdw2+orwkMuYDCm1pWhY7vk7Wk57FykVuGKFDNvI5NGV9vc3r0joKbB4;31:Hp0LSR3z7CzvwA9ibWLj0iIZAbxq1BASw3lgO5NFnf0+qcy9Wuqq/ZdNaurg8zq+NzR5VQsYWabXiUjp4s1l4sSPnpFKNtUUyQ9Phvhl+eHmR2+y7D9f6yWQd7DP5rN/GLPvEideAK7gzvMLc0iqsTl1MMJJ9nNtbdtpd0IAtYJAMicZiOKE/tLbsH8803lH6Miy0zwws+7mn01xNDVa7Q==
X-MS-Exchange-Organization-AVStamp-Service: 1.0
X-Exchange-Antispam-Report-Test: UriScan:;
X-Exchange-Antispam-Report-CFA-Test: 

BCL:0;PCL:0;RULEID:(102415321)(9101531078)(601004)(2401047)(7630418)(8121501046)(13018025)(13016025)(7631346)(7632298)(7633261)(10201501046)(3002001);SRVR:DM5PR11MB1643;BCL:0;PCL:0;RULEID:;SRVR:DM5PR11MB1643;
X-Microsoft-Exchange-Diagnostics: 

1;DM5PR11MB1643;4:Qvs43CNYOGaFsCRamuIu4/U7j6Wo09UWpHJmwYPPhdu5TDFA+36qiyKMuoxNFYhF1KXtSoIqYI0Lk0eOShvKxNM3ztfdNNKWHNYuvLx7YLIUUSBcTx7IbeinhUFcb7FrOYeDmVolXsWBvHgVc1ZVGVsPgGutezTKn+S7OejwcZ3uViqmSuGrsgX2cgt+oYJzqQYxxhhEQTRErXQ92Pu1ptq7mShaF/OCP3zpVqcPHlbOU3vaQ1pBbcoUwQNieajad3psxcwu0pD0eIce7ZkO6mt4bW9034ZPACylLPYoRKipFUpYurYovgAcyRGTCI69mHk7iik19m9qnZaklZ/46Gpe5qz4DVqTm/lEw3oVHVqeOgkRUmLmeF8Bhp91HdrHjZafmNY9IF3C9wjkSQ1EcqzXYH73aT8JmeZslPcMAhqXLzR6wI1aCerR1dX4VtcEKPM2qA2HA8Gys3apAiF64TicMNYmQGan7fa6B/6qa2WamkzcPWbnZihw5eWRrZ7f
X-MS-Exchange-Organization-SCL: 1
X-Microsoft-Exchange-Diagnostics: 

1;DM5PR11MB1643;23:dSPPaVmRePV1krbrUHeuRy+/QUySRaCdF3N2wjeEmhXFETqdWhFUr6oViks/SQuuvdGiBOI2VSTpj1Ig4fKb1BKnUbQhfujVFc70jIVziFjGY5dWcgePxPw4sV1rD0rt+x0ZpED+aMLpS+bmv1Zb3W+ANFzFDpmUnvFAqpJHQxxAUa4fgjRZ+rppsVltd3jxBxQtuhPskk+IHeWQNeC/u1Ctw8YqKOry/WblQPkd9rv1UBUJaCQbzTS7913qAggc+3WQMkIeX7ieS2Bdt8d0G97kH6xaHwJV1OhfmKjoFQ6sd5seXHDJQEPQdeYVzT7FtqQPFgSQNPiHqrr8/Ed5hI1LOIi1tv8uPO+eJVb6plUl28rjsH66hzAevwu/KU1UWPJUqGO/drFQyqiZcpalpJ+AnJdJzfZkEhsGb0zdMHpkWyG2nvYk2l2DNlQWUFkSJDwEcoLFF1lKzbhcpgHgPB1EZgGAANQ+c/HnygNd+nF1wMs/iotRp3BSutCYe7tF06S12b+jXv4CcclFDSrAdUnL+DHSaZNRlYIEt23wOVxUBFYNRJjQEy5/RJUjO18W0HaPTQ8wEd9yQjEufcw8RusV+zNFxIwM5d5RBt0FL5itY6sG1x/FKhobL8JJABVia+OzD81ioxT32b8dFNWRGPtV98HpfgHuyr8UdEc7dTqDnj58xKkh7I588kMVNK0H8uAbiSgViZdPZSQJjomAR/k+u1WZRtqBVRwm6ZOvEU/rjtP8mIwXbTigSSzP366DPEtTmkGvHVG5wbvjriE88affBBaw/UmVmA+kESy8n1IZHslAAtvDsRpas1USgpakpuHSvzsrVuqyN37s6G9JhkatHPq2CiBZsGl0XozGExGsR8eIkyfi87/RbNLyi1mo28OZEU7q0PqhfeQsSwbaXSmsWh0d7u82oaW9M0r5xvHenYxJD8BbbAxa1zMl7pJzn0OmNVw8saZH+fLpFSmbx5JIDHIhGM1oQN4kabv1L5CCsJbHmglZBNvXC2qy2eVjIFOf+X0r0L20dPUCgGskzrCkNJwOu7WB/oKKHxsNa3s/CgZ2SJtSIMImor3yVo0yI9rYTI4ZBQq3Gu5FlBgLb9aBDNwtNmGO3JtgdZIcEL7cJIMFKEPnZA7uX2QWszFMSURVE+hpYLCp5QtIhLc6Nr4FVSrkhc2r8sC05pYGIfDaMKsXL8kLFrXBU2qdhLr+/K8zmNPfm/C2DEbgdjs/MXYQwib93ebKUGQQ0w3Xa6CDIpsCeK6MHSh2auq28k/Wn/PmWQ0GpFAMdPg0Rtu4bg==
X-Microsoft-Exchange-Diagnostics: 

1;DM5PR11MB1643;6:h1Yux6e+TCPgnQmSdM6+p1+9ilHibwO5BsyQ8uX7mf2bcqs17FMprNGokKH7dj6nJBq2WcPn//qo2lUwJEhriXU0u+Gp+GuMHjCbMoIv9g3VhZDGV/7xTwuJCWe2hlsXQuIR9Y7S0KMr7GjwiXCTZmSxfMyBZSyI5BeD7AZob33Ci2ElJLYrRVdWFBTxnDfTGtMe/Gyrex+iweKwZU5T5UElZv6B/007qLmdmnggMgR/MZA2LYFBTLl2fiVzhH4fAGcAnHRxrtw4ISDatxKtpoo7w5ErwnPIN6MCAAtME3RmXK+iUWSyRqdCtUCoTMtQ;5:Bn++v8qeCM31o4EUBdEXuAH+qCmRZNTBsY5tbBSYs+tVPz+yCn1X05yvHsclFS455mEMvEfOiXcmzJGp+sh1PnP0b1183HQudd+R5mviYM+nQ8qytjG8LSZrLSO6yCaznemhbjLSsYdw0stnEuok+Q==;24:uovz29cF/UsMKISK0pYg7fhHAm7oGMMAXOA1XEBU3pNKAokAZR0rJJ313IOdGQh+m2daT0bRVP5+/P0pWkNGni1GY+erMS8FfIHcnIQRjl4=;7:3IyPlI/qq3GJ8NZ0T6SSIXXq0KmK2vbLGBbiAddfto0tCBfJxSqG3yKZPw3q1gsrXw+6cE1OL/fAwykai0uDLqwXoy9AoIopR38w9xFg+LATHCJbmifDb/qc31QC8jEFwxK23vg9nnE0mDC3jXCwucbPhXwdY2RNVeXe6KKKj5HERpOeoK+c/fT35rhcRRwjrzJ2ztTimFEJ7l+tl/j85Sxig0ofQpV44EDc0jIZ9cGVs9YFcqwQR+zIxceVeVd+FNXie3ffRaXg0yALy5dydA==
SpamDiagnosticOutput: 1:99
SpamDiagnosticMetadata: NSPM
X-MS-Exchange-CrossTenant-OriginalArrivalTime: 21 Jul 2016 22:03:56.5220 
(UTC)
X-MS-Exchange-CrossTenant-Id: 05027110-dcb3-458e-866d-b4ec88120732
X-MS-Exchange-CrossTenant-FromEntityHeader: Internet
X-MS-Exchange-Transport-CrossTenantHeadersStamped: DM5PR11MB1643
X-MS-Exchange-Organization-AuthSource: BY2FFO11FD047.protection.gbl
X-MS-Exchange-Organization-AuthAs: Anonymous
X-MS-Exchange-Transport-EndToEndLatency: 00:00:01.2025566
X-Microsoft-Exchange-Diagnostics: 

1;CY4PR11MB1637;9:mh+F1xXA37UmwoWEnkS2I/l1//0S69sMzAsJDm6MgRxMQ1WpCV9Ual3C/sDfdnYS/1KPpxNzIml3frO8u68PnzNjyCcm65IzowCKH54tPoApPodUGp09VUdB5eSsRmXXKdhAMmFdWv68gzcAmLz8QkdP6EGY9sT2ulUzZj50QRsp3ePj5Awc0sPRoZxOoOGXdy/4Ji+19R+3hndbLLDYzw==
MIME-Version: 1.0

Your message to pgsql-general has been delayed, and requires the 
approval of the moderators, for the following reason(s):

The message headers are too large (8193 > 8000)

If you do not wish the message to be posted, or have other concerns, 
please send a message to the list owners at the following address: 
pgsql-general-owner@postgresql.org

On 7/20/16 1:14 PM, Mark Lybarger wrote:
> This leads me to think I need to create 2^5 or 32 unique constraints to
> handle the various combinations of data that I can store.

Another option would be to create a unique index of a bit varying field
that set a bit to true for each field that was NULL WHERE <bit varying
field> != 0.

Let me know if you want to go that route, I could probably add that to
http://pgxn.org/dist/count_nulls/ without much difficulty. Though,
probably a better way to accomplish that would be to add a function to
count_nulls that spits out an array of fields that are NULL; you could
then do a unique index on that WHERE array != array[].

Maybe a less obtuse option would be to use a boolean array. Storage
would be ~8x larger, but since there should be very few rows I doubt
that matters.
--
Jim Nasby, Data Architect, Blue Treble Consulting, Austin TX
Experts in Analytics, Data Architecture and PostgreSQL
Data in Trouble? Get it in Treble! http://BlueTreble.com
855-TREBLE2 (855-873-2532)   mobile: 512-569-9461



В списке pgsql-www по дате отправления:

Предыдущее
От: Alvaro Herrera
Дата:
Сообщение: Re: Wiki editor request
Следующее
От: Joe Conway
Дата:
Сообщение: Re: Fwd: Stalled post to pgsql-general